+char *string_replace_substring(const char *in,
+ const char *pattern, const char *replacement)
+{
+ size_t numhits, pattern_len, replacement_len, outlen;
+ const char *inat = NULL;
+ const char *inprev = NULL;
+ char *out = NULL;
+ char *outat = NULL;
+
+ /* if either pattern or replacement is NULL,
+ * duplicate in and let caller handle it. */
+ if (!pattern || !replacement)
+ return strdup(in);
+
+ pattern_len = strlen(pattern);
+ replacement_len = strlen(replacement);
+ numhits = 0;
+ inat = in;
+
+ while ((inat = strstr(inat, pattern)))
+ {
+ inat += pattern_len;
+ numhits++;
+ }
+
+ outlen = strlen(in) - pattern_len*numhits + replacement_len*numhits;
+ out = (char *)malloc(outlen+1);
+
+ if (!out)
+ return NULL;
+
+ outat = out;
+ inat = in;
+ inprev = in;
+
+ while ((inat = strstr(inat, pattern)))
+ {
+ memcpy(outat, inprev, inat-inprev);
+ outat += inat-inprev;
+ memcpy(outat, replacement, replacement_len);
+ outat += replacement_len;
+ inat += pattern_len;
+ inprev = inat;
+ }
+ strcpy(outat, inprev);
+
+ return out;
+}

+/* Remove leading whitespaces */
+char *string_trim_whitespace_left(char *const s)
+{
+ if (s && *s)
+ {
+ size_t len = strlen(s);
+ char *current = s;
+
+ while (*current && ISSPACE((unsigned char)*current))
+ {
+ ++current;
+ --len;
+ }
+
+ if (s != current)
+ memmove(s, current, len + 1);
+ }
+
+ return s;
+}
+
+/* Remove trailing whitespaces */
+char *string_trim_whitespace_right(char *const s)
+{
+ if (s && *s)
+ {
+ size_t len = strlen(s);
+ char *current = s + len - 1;
+
+ while (current != s && ISSPACE((unsigned char)*current))
+ {
+ --current;
+ --len;
+ }
+
+ current[ISSPACE((unsigned char)*current) ? 0 : 1] = '\0';
+ }
+
+ return s;
+}
+
+/* Remove leading and trailing whitespaces */
+char *string_trim_whitespace(char *const s)
+{
+ string_trim_whitespace_right(s); /* order matters */
+ string_trim_whitespace_left(s);
+
+ return s;
+}

+void word_wrap_wideglyph(char *dst, size_t dst_size, const char *src, int line_width, int wideglyph_width, unsigned max_lines)
+{
+ char *lastspace = NULL;
+ char *lastwideglyph = NULL;
+ const char *src_end = src + strlen(src);
+ unsigned lines = 1;
+ /* 'line_width' means max numbers of characters per line,
+ * but this metric is only meaningful when dealing with
+ * 'regular' glyphs that have an on-screen pixel width
+ * similar to that of regular Latin characters.
+ * When handing so-called 'wide' Unicode glyphs, it is
+ * necessary to consider the actual on-screen pixel width
+ * of each character.
+ * In order to do this, we create a distinction between
+ * regular Latin 'non-wide' glyphs and 'wide' glyphs, and
+ * normalise all values relative to the on-screen pixel
+ * width of regular Latin characters:
+ * - Regular 'non-wide' glyphs have a normalised width of 100
+ * - 'line_width' is therefore normalised to 100 * (width_in_characters)
+ * - 'wide' glyphs have a normalised width of
+ * 100 * (wide_character_pixel_width / latin_character_pixel_width)
+ * - When a character is detected, the position in the current
+ * line is incremented by the regular normalised width of 100
+ * - If that character is then determined to be a 'wide'
+ * glyph, the position in the current line is further incremented
+ * by the difference between the normalised 'wide' and 'non-wide'
+ * width values */
+ unsigned counter_normalized = 0;
+ int line_width_normalized = line_width * 100;
+ int additional_counter_normalized = wideglyph_width - 100;
+
+ /* Early return if src string length is less
+ * than line width */
+ if (src_end - src < line_width)
+ {
+ strlcpy(dst, src, dst_size);
+ return;
+ }
+
+ while (*src != '\0')
+ {
+ unsigned char_len;
+
+ char_len = (unsigned)(utf8skip(src, 1) - src);
+ counter_normalized += 100;
+
+ /* Prevent buffer overflow */
+ if (char_len >= dst_size)
+ break;
+
+ if (*src == ' ')
+ lastspace = dst; /* Remember the location of the whitespace */
+ else if (*src == '\n')
+ {
+ /* If newlines embedded in the input,
+ * reset the index */
+ lines++;
+ counter_normalized = 0;
+
+ /* Early return if remaining src string
+ * length is less than line width */
+ if (src_end - src <= line_width)
+ {
+ strlcpy(dst, src, dst_size);
+ return;
+ }
+ }
+ else if (char_len >= 3)
+ {
+ /* Remember the location of the first byte
+ * whose length as UTF-8 >= 3*/
+ lastwideglyph = dst;
+ counter_normalized += additional_counter_normalized;
+ }
+
+ dst_size -= char_len;
+ while (char_len--)
+ *dst++ = *src++;
+
+ if (counter_normalized >= (unsigned)line_width_normalized)
+ {
+ counter_normalized = 0;
+
+ if (max_lines != 0 && lines >= max_lines)
+ continue;
+ else if (lastwideglyph && (!lastspace || lastwideglyph > lastspace))
+ {
+ /* Insert newline character */
+ *lastwideglyph = '\n';
+ lines++;
+ src -= dst - lastwideglyph;
+ dst = lastwideglyph + 1;
+ lastwideglyph = NULL;
+
+ /* Early return if remaining src string
+ * length is less than line width */
+ if (src_end - src <= line_width)
+ {
+ strlcpy(dst, src, dst_size);
+ return;
+ }
+ }
+ else if (lastspace)
+ {
+ /* Replace nearest (previous) whitespace
+ * with newline character */
+ *lastspace = '\n';
+ lines++;
+ src -= dst - lastspace - 1;
+ dst = lastspace + 1;
+ lastspace = NULL;
+
+ /* Early return if remaining src string
+ * length is less than line width */
+ if (src_end - src < line_width)
+ {
+ strlcpy(dst, src, dst_size);
+ return;
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 }
+
+ *dst = '\0';
+}

+/* Splits string into tokens seperated by 'delim'
+ * > Returned token string must be free()'d
+ * > Returns NULL if token is not found
+ * > After each call, 'str' is set to the position after the
+ * last found token
+ * > Tokens *include* empty strings
+ * Usage example:
+ * char *str = "1,2,3,4,5,6,7,,,10,";
+ * char **str_ptr = &str;
+ * char *token = NULL;
+ * while ((token = string_tokenize(str_ptr, ",")))
+ * {
+ * printf("%s\n", token);
+ * free(token);
+ * token = NULL;
+ * }
+ */
+char* string_tokenize(char **str, const char *delim)
+{
+ /* Taken from https://codereview.stackexchange.com/questions/216956/strtok-function-thread-safe-supports-empty-tokens-doesnt-change-string# */
+ char *str_ptr = NULL;
+ char *delim_ptr = NULL;
+ char *token = NULL;
+ size_t token_len = 0;
+
+ /* Sanity checks */
+ if (!str || string_is_empty(delim))
+ return NULL;
+
+ str_ptr = *str;
+
+ /* Note: we don't check string_is_empty() here,
+ * empty strings are valid */
+ if (!str_ptr)
+ return NULL;
+
+ /* Search for delimiter */
+ delim_ptr = strstr(str_ptr, delim);
+
+ if (delim_ptr)
+ token_len = delim_ptr - str_ptr;
+ else
+ token_len = strlen(str_ptr);
+
+ /* Allocate token string */
+ token = (char *)malloc((token_len + 1) * sizeof(char));
+
+ if (!token)
+ return NULL;
+
+ /* Copy token */
+ strlcpy(token, str_ptr, (token_len + 1) * sizeof(char));
+ token[token_len] = '\0';
+
+ /* Update input string pointer */
+ *str = delim_ptr ? delim_ptr + strlen(delim) : NULL;
+
+ return token;
+}
